Biostatistics Lead at Maryland Global Initiatives Corporation (MGIC)


The Maryland Global Initiatives Corporation (MGIC) is a non-profit affiliate of UMB with a mission to administratively support international operations of UMB Principal Investigators. Our purpose is to provide the administrative infrastructure for sizable and sustained operations outside of the U.S. Currently, MGIC operates in Kenya, Nigeria, Rwanda, Tanzania, and Zambia, with registration application in-process in Haiti. These operations support the research and clinical programs of the SOM, Institute of Human Virology.

Job Title: Biostatistics Lead

Location: Abuja
Employment Type: Full-time

Responsibilities

  • Supports Biostatistics lead in running of Biostatistics unit
  • Provide biostatistical consultation to clients or colleagues
  • Develop guidelines for how data should be collected
  • Determination of sample size requirements for studies.
  • Determine project plans, timelines, or technical objectives for statistical aspects of biological research studies
  • Draw conclusions or make predictions based on data summaries or statistical analyses.
  • Design surveys to assess health issues.
  • Develop or implement data analysis algorithms.
  • Collect data through surveys or experimentation.
  • Develop or use mathematical models to track changes in biological phenomena such as the spread of infectious diseases.
  • Review clinical or other medical research protocols and recommend appropriate statistical analyses.
  • Analyze clinical or survey data using statistical approaches such as longitudinal analysis, mixed effect modeling, logistic regression analyses, and model building techniques
  • Write program code to analyze data using statistical analysis software
  • Prepare statistical data for inclusion in reports to data monitoring committees, federal regulatory agencies, managers, or clients.
  • Prepare articles for publication or presentation at professional conferences.
  • Write detailed analysis plans and descriptions of analyses and findings for research protocols or reports.
  • Prepare tables and graphs to present clinical data or results.

Requirements

  • A Master's degree in Mathematics, Statistics, biostatistics, epidemiology, or related scientific field is required. A PhD is an advantage
  • Interpersonal/Individual Competencies: the ability to work with other team members, flexibility, decisiveness, and personal integrity
  • Experience: Minimum 5 years working experience doing data analysis or epidemiology
  • Specialized knowledge: Expert use of at least 2 data management and analysis tools
  • Skills: Strong mathematical skills, Statistics skills, Problem-solving, Adaptability, Written and oral communications skills, Strong teamwork skills, Critical thinking, and Strong computer background

Professional Certification:

  • Certification in any applicable Health care professional body is desirable but not required
